1. Non-Compliance with California Vape Regulations
At the core of the cannabis vape license revocation issue is non-compliance with California vape regulations. The California Department of Cannabis Control (DCC) has been enforcing its stringent rules around testing and labeling, particularly with the rise of contaminated vape products in the market. Vape manufacturers must meet strict safety standards, especially for products like cannabis vape cartridges.
One of the key regulations revolves around product testing for heavy metals, residual solvents, and pesticides. Any company that fails to comply with these testing requirements risks having its license revoked. 2. Health Risks Linked to Contaminated Vape Products
One of the most alarming issues contributing to vape manufacturer license revocations in California is the presence of contaminated vape products. There have been cases of cannabis vape cartridges being found with traces of pesticides, mold, and heavy metals, which pose significant health risks to consumers.
Consumers have reported experiencing adverse effects from contaminated vapes, such as respiratory problems and allergic reactions. This has led to recalls and, in some cases, severe penalties for companies that failed to ensure the safety of their products. 3. Improper Labeling and Misleading Claims
Another major reason for license revocation is improper labeling. California’s cannabis industry has strict labeling requirements to ensure transparency for consumers. Misleading claims about product potency, ingredients, or health benefits can result in serious consequences.
For example, some companies have had their licenses revoked due to falsely advertising their products as “organic” or “pesticide-free” when lab tests revealed otherwise. This lack of transparency not only damages consumer trust but also puts companies at odds with California cannabis regulatory compliance.
4. Failure to Comply with Product Recall Procedures
Product recalls in the cannabis industry are essential for maintaining public safety, especially when harmful products are found. California regulators expect manufacturers to comply promptly with recall procedures. When companies fail to recall contaminated or non-compliant vape products in a timely manner, it results in legal actions and potential license revocations.

5. Inadequate Testing for Pesticides and Heavy Metals
California vape regulations mandate that all cannabis vape products undergo rigorous testing for pesticides, heavy metals, and other harmful substances. Some manufacturers, however, have cut corners, either skipping required testing procedures or working with uncertified labs that don’t follow state protocols.
The use of pesticides like myclobutanil, which becomes toxic when heated, has been flagged as a major issue. Products containing untested or inadequately tested materials have contributed to license revocations across the state.

7. Illicit Market Involvement
California has long battled the presence of the illicit cannabis market, and regulators are cracking down on any licensed manufacturers that have ties to unlicensed cannabis operations. Some manufacturers have been found sourcing products or raw materials from the illicit market, leading to immediate license revocations.

How Cannabis Businesses Can Stay Compliant
As California continues to tighten its grip on cannabis industry regulations, it’s essential for vape manufacturers to prioritize safety, transparency, and compliance. Here are a few key ways businesses can stay compliant and avoid the cannabis vape license revocation:
- Regular Testing: Ensure all products are tested in state-certified labs for pesticides, heavy metals, and other harmful substances.
- Clear and Accurate Labeling: Follow California’s strict labeling laws and avoid misleading claims about product safety or efficacy.
- Stay Updated on Regulatory Changes: Continuously monitor updates to cannabis regulations and adjust business practices accordingly.
- Prompt Product Recalls: Have a system in place to swiftly recall any non-compliant products from the market.
- Avoid Illicit Market Associations: Ensure all materials and products are sourced through legal and licensed channels.
